    Ambiance: 10/10 Service: 9/10…read moreFood: 7/10 PRO TIP: come first served, so arrive early if you want your choice of spots and don't want to get stuck in standing room only. Had a fabulous time at this club! I came on Tuesday, May 19th to see Tanerèlle with a friend. Show started at 7, doors opened at 5. We arrived ~6. That timing was perfect tbh We had ample time to get situated, validate our parking, order and devour our food without stressing about hurrying up for the show. The only way to experience this venue well is to get there early. Only issue with this place is the food, perhaps unsurprisingly, is very overpriced for what it is. I paid $40 for a salmon dish that resembled a dish I could easily make at home. Home. It was just salmon, mashed potatoes and broccolini. Nothing to write home about. And they pull world-class talent in such an intimate setting. I'm so grateful we have a jazz club like this in LA now. Will be back!

    Hadn't been here in a while, til a friend said - let's go see Luis Conte and some of his gang…read more WOW!!! First, the place is as I remembered - tiny, a bit cramped, and LEGENDARY! Every seat is literally 15 feet from the stage. If you're going, you better love the band and their music, because you will be right in the middle of it. Second, there's every type of baked potato imaginable- except "baked potato ropa vieja" - suggested by Luis Conte himself! Third, yes you need to stand in line before going in - worth it if you love the band that's playing. Sr Conte and his boys knocked it out. There were several guest musicians, and - surprise, surprise! - Andy Garcia himself joining in; he and Sr Conte are pals. If you haven't heard this group play, you must! And if it's at the Baked Potato, all the better. Will be back soon...
